While not a widely known or common name, there are a few notable individuals with the name Bartram. One of them is William Bartram (1739-1823), an American naturalist, botanist, and artist. He is famous for his book "Travels through North and South Carolina, Georgia, East and West Florida," which documented his explorations of the southeastern United States.
